Concept of Par in Futures Trading
In this context of financial law, the following are some alternative definitions of Par: (a) Refers to the standard delivery point(s) and/or quality of a commodity that is deliverable on a futures contract at contract price. Serves as a benchmark upon which to base discounts or premiums for varying quality and delivery locations; (b) in bond markets, an index (usually 100) representing the face value of a bond.
